Top Flip Opportunities
- North Carolina - We recruited Gov. Roy Cooper – a proven Democratic leader who’s never lost an election.
- Ohio - Sherrod Brown stepped up to run. He is beloved statewide with name recognition, and running against an appointed opponent.
- Maine - Susan Collins is in her weakest position ever as she faces down a tough Democrat challenge.
- Alaska - Mary Peltola – a proven statewide winner in a purple state who puts cost-of-living and health care first, is ready to flip this seat.
- Iowa - Democrats are over-performing in recent special elections here, and Republicans are getting nervous.
- Texas - In recent years, Democrats have been gaining ground. Republicans are burning tens of millions of dollars in a chaotic primary, paving the way for Democratic momentum.
